Will the Schneider 135mm APO-SYMMAR MC for Linhof Technorama 612 fit the 1st version body too? E If it is in the 612 board yes. The 58mm won’t fit the 1st version and early 2nd ones. All the other lenses, up to 180 fit both versions. Extremely sturdy black camera neck strap embroidered with the red Linhof logo. 612 pc II 6x12cm Panoramic Camera with Perspective Control

A camera with no limits: Professional format 6×12 cm on rollfilm including perspective control hand-held. The dynamic 2 : 1 aspect ratio permits 6 exposures on rollfilm 120 or 12 frames on 220 in vertical or horizontal orienta­tion of the film plane. The built-in 8 mm rise of the lens avoids converging lines. The ultimate tool for a user who specialises in architectural, interior, industrial, travel and technically scenic photo-graphy. The LinhofTechnorama 612PC is a panoramic rollfilm camera designed for the 6×12cm film format. The 612PC was originally intended as a replacement for the 6×17cm Technorama, but Linhof eventually decided to sell both cameras. The 612PC normally used a Schneider Super Angulon 65 mm/5.6 lens to emphasize the sweeping nature of the 6×12 format, but could also be fitted with a Carl Zeiss Sonnar 135mm/5.6 lens. The camera is optimized for use on a horizontal axis, and is equipped with 8mm of built-in vertical shift to limit excessive foreground without tilting the camera.
